Joe Dunne believes Colchester United’s fans will be patient with the journey that their team is on.

The U’s assistant manager says the team is embarking on a new path this season, with boss John Ward introducing changes to the way they play.

One particular highlight so far was the 4-1 hammering of Oldham in the U’s last npower League One outing at home and they will be looking for a similar show when Leyton Orient come to the Weston Homes Community Stadium tomorrow.

It is a more attacking style that the players are having to adapt to this year and while it may bring frustrations when things don’t work, Dunne feels the fans appreciate what is trying to be achieved.

He said: “I’ve been here a long time and I know our fans are good and stick with the team.

“There may be some frustration, but they understand it is a learning curve for us all."
